Project Overview

The goal of this project is to enhance the appeal of a juggler’s performance. The aim of this specific project is to create LED Juggling Balls that will enhance the visual aspect of the performance of a juggler by changing color upon contact with the juggler's hands, and turning red if they hit the ground. These balls, specifically, will be transparent, and each have an Arduino inside, attached to an accelerometer, breadboard, and LED lights. Some challenges that need to be overcome to meet this goal include deciding which type of sensor to use. Also, understanding how to attach this sensor to an Arduino will be a new experience and could create some challenges. The major tasks that need to be accomplished include programming the Arduino to turn the LED lights’ inside of the balls color on being touched, and turning red when the ball hits the ground. Another major task is to assemble the lights and sensors into three translucent balls to create a working prototype.
